Duties
Making a Difference: HUD's Mission
HUD's mission is to create strong, sustainable, inclusive communities and quality affordable homes for all. HUD is working to strengthen the housing market to bolster the economy and protect consumers; meet the need for quality affordable rental homes; utilize housing as a platform for improving quality of life; build inclusive and sustainable communities free from discrimination and transform the way HUD does business.
As a Senior Funding Specialist, you will:
  • Work independently and conduct project assessments to ensure that all funding available for various programs is utilized to its maximum potential; that projects with the greater needs are addressed and funded properly; and that funding actions are processed promptly.
  • Independently resolve funding issues considered atypical, keeping the Division Director and Branch Chiefs informed of the situation and progress towards resolution.
  • Identify, analyze, and resolve issues that may conflict with changing regulations, past precedents, current policies, and procedures.
  • Receive assignments through the Division Director or Branch Chiefs and independently perform the funding control functions for the office, monitor expenditures and balances, and prepare funding requests with appropriate explanation and guidance.

Qualifications
You must meet the following requirements by the closing date of this announcement.
For the GS-13 level, specialized experience is at least one year of experience at the GS-12 level, or equivalent that has equipped you with the knowledge, skills and abilities to successfully perform the duties of this position. Specialized experience includes:
  • Comprehensive knowledge of administrative and technical work as relative to funding principles, practices, methods and techniques for the processing, maintaining and tracking of all Multifamily housing funding assignments; AND
  • Interpreting and applying laws, regulations, and precedents applicable to funding; AND
  • Independently and proactively identifying issues that could cause a delay in the receipt of funding at the project level and initiating prompt corrective action and intervention.

Experience may have been gained in either the public, private sector or volunteer service. One year of experience refers to full-time work; part-time work is considered on a prorated basis. How You Will Be Evaluated
You will be evaluated for this job based on how well you meet the qualifications above.
Your application includes your resume, responses to the online questions, and required supporting documents. Please be sure that your resume includes detailed information to support your qualifications for this position; failure to provide sufficient evidence in your resume may result in a "not qualified" determination.
Rating: Your application will be evaluated in the following areas: Administrative Management, Communication, Planning and Evaluating, and Technical.
Category rating will be used to rank and select eligible candidates. If qualified, you will be assigned to one of three quality level categories: Best (highest quality category), Better (middle quality category), or Good (minimally qualified category) depending on your responses to the online questions, regarding your experience, education, and training related to this position. Your rating may be lowered if your responses to the online questions are not supported by the education and/or experience described in your application.
Veterans' preference is applied after applicants are assessed. Preference-eligibles will be listed at the top of their assigned category and considered before non-preference-eligibles in that category.
Qualified preference-eligibles with a compensable service-connected disability of 10% or more will be listed at the top of the highest category.
Referral: If you are among the top qualified candidates, your application may be referred to a selecting official for consideration. You may be required to participate in a selection interview.
If you are a displaced or surplus Federal employee (eligible for the Career Transition Assistance Plan (CTAP)/Interagency Career Transition Assistance Plan (ICTAP)) you must receive a score in the middle quality category or better to be rated as "well qualified" to receive special selection priority.
